TestMaster Pro-AI-Powered Testing Assistant

Automate Testing with AI Insight

Home > GPTs > TestMaster Pro
Get Embed Code
YesChatTestMaster Pro

Analyze the input fields of the application page and identify...

Generate sample data for the testing fields, ensuring to include...

List all the elements with their corresponding labels and types, focusing on...

Calculate the necessary test coverage to ensure comprehensive evaluation of...

Rate this tool

20.0 / 5 (200 votes)

Understanding TestMaster Pro

TestMaster Pro is a sophisticated tool designed for comprehensive testing and analysis of software applications. It's engineered to identify potential defects, analyze application pages for areas susceptible to errors, and generate sample data for field testing across various data types. Through its detailed examination, TestMaster Pro aids in enhancing the quality and reliability of software applications. For instance, when assessing a web application, TestMaster Pro can automatically scan through forms, identifying fields that may not validate input correctly, or find user interface elements that might not be accessible or responsive under certain conditions. This proactive identification helps developers and testers rectify issues before they impact end-users. Powered by ChatGPT-4o

Core Functions of TestMaster Pro

  • Automatic Defect Identification

    Example Example

    Detecting fields in a web form that accept values outside of expected ranges, leading to potential security vulnerabilities.

    Example Scenario

    During a scan of an e-commerce checkout form, TestMaster Pro identifies that the credit card input field does not properly validate card numbers, allowing for the input of alphanumeric characters, which could facilitate fraudulent transactions.

  • Sample Data Generation

    Example Example

    Creating a diverse set of test data for user registration forms, including edge cases like extremely long names or invalid email formats.

    Example Scenario

    To test a new user registration process, TestMaster Pro generates a suite of test cases, including valid entries, boundary conditions, and invalid inputs to ensure the form robustly handles all types of data without errors.

  • Element Labeling and Type Identification

    Example Example

    Cataloging each element on a web page with its associated label and data type to aid in automated testing.

    Example Scenario

    In an audit of a financial application's loan application page, TestMaster Pro lists all input fields, checkboxes, and dropdown menus along with their expected data types, helping testers quickly create test scripts tailored to each element.

  • Equivalence Partitioning

    Example Example

    Dividing input data into partitions that should be treated the same way by the system, to reduce the total number of test cases needed while ensuring comprehensive coverage.

    Example Scenario

    For an airline booking system, TestMaster Pro suggests equivalence partitions for seat selection, such as window, aisle, or middle seats, enabling testers to efficiently verify the booking process without having to test every seat individually.

Who Benefits from TestMaster Pro?

  • Software Developers

    Developers benefit from TestMaster Pro's ability to preemptively identify potential issues in their code, allowing for corrections before deployment. This ensures a higher quality product and a reduction in post-deployment bug fixes.

  • Quality Assurance Professionals

    QA professionals utilize TestMaster Pro to streamline their testing processes, leveraging its capabilities to generate test data and identify areas of concern. This enhances their ability to conduct thorough testing, ensuring software meets all quality standards.

  • Product Managers

    Product managers can use TestMaster Pro to keep track of the quality assurance process, ensuring that their product is not only functional but also meets the highest quality standards before it reaches the customer, thus aiding in decision-making and prioritization.

How to Use TestMaster Pro

  • Start Your Journey

    Navigate to yeschat.ai to initiate your experience with TestMaster Pro, accessible for a free trial without the need for ChatGPT Plus or any login requirements.

  • Explore Features

    Familiarize yourself with TestMaster Pro's features through the interactive tutorial available on the homepage. This will help you understand how to leverage the tool for your testing needs.

  • Define Your Test Criteria

    Identify the application or software component you wish to test. Clearly outline your testing objectives, including the types of tests (e.g., unit, integration, system) and the target environment.

  • Generate Test Cases

    Utilize TestMaster Pro to generate test cases, sample data, and identify potential defect areas. Input your requirements to receive tailored testing scenarios and data.

  • Analyze and Implement

    Review the generated test cases and sample data. Implement these in your testing environment and analyze the results to identify any defects or areas for improvement.

Frequently Asked Questions about TestMaster Pro

  • What makes TestMaster Pro unique from other testing tools?

    TestMaster Pro stands out by offering AI-powered analysis of application pages to identify potential defect areas, generating sample data for various field types, and providing detailed test coverage calculations. Its intuitive design and comprehensive testing approach make it a valuable asset for testers.

  • Can TestMaster Pro generate test cases for any application?

    Yes, TestMaster Pro is designed to generate test cases across a wide range of applications, from web to mobile, considering various data types and user interactions. Its versatility makes it suitable for a broad spectrum of testing scenarios.

  • How does TestMaster Pro handle data privacy?

    TestMaster Pro prioritizes data privacy by ensuring that all user inputs and generated test data are processed securely within the platform. It adheres to strict data protection regulations to safeguard user information.

  • Is TestMaster Pro suitable for novice testers?

    Absolutely. TestMaster Pro offers an interactive tutorial and user-friendly interface that make it accessible to both novice and experienced testers. Its automated features help users learn and apply testing concepts effectively.

  • Can TestMaster Pro integrate with existing testing frameworks?

    While TestMaster Pro primarily functions as a standalone tool, it generates test cases and data that can be manually integrated into existing testing frameworks and environments, enhancing the testing process.